Tutorial 202 | Calculate price to reach a user input RSI value
Description
Tutorial 202 seeks to look at the RSI calculation and calculate what price (this bar) needs to be for the RSI to reach (or go down to) a specific value.
To achieve this the calculations the RSI calculations are solved for Price (i.e. price this bar). Because the above formula includes AbsValue, we actually solve for two eventualities (i.e when price is greater than price last bar and when price last bar is greater than price this bar).
